Hey fellas, seeing as you're in the central FL, just wanted to invite y'all to Crucible 2 in March, 2013

crucible-orl.blogspot.com

In the meantime, there's Phoenix Games on the west side of Orlando, Paladin and Amorous Armadillo on the East and a GW store up in Altamonte. Over here on the coast in Palm Bay, 40K is heating way up and then there's Anthem and Armada Games over in Tampa. All the independent stores have forums and you'll probably have good luck connecting with folks on them. Just google!
